[−][src]Struct bls_like::pop::CountPoPSignedMessage
One individual message with attached aggreggate BLS signatures from signers for whom we previously checked proofs-of-possession, and with the singers presented as a compact bitfield.
We may aggregage any number of duplicate signatures per signer here,
unlike CountPoPSignedMessage
, but our serialized signature costs
one 96 or or 48 bytes compressed curve point, plus the size of
ProofsOfPossession::Signers
times log of the largest duplicate
count.
You must provide a ProofsOfPossession
for this, likely by
implementing it for your own data structures.
Fields
max_duplicates: usize
Errors if a duplicate signature count would exceed this number.
We suggest rounding up to the nearest power of two.
